Medusa II — Quick Facts
| Provider | NetEnt |
|---|---|
| Theme | Greek Mythology |
| Released | Dec 2014 |
| RTP | 97.10% |
| Volatility | Medium |
| Max Win | 200x |
| Reels | 5×3 |
| Paylines / Ways | 243 |
| Min Bet | $0.25 |
| Max Bet | $125.00 |
| Hit Frequency | Not confirmed |
| Features | Free Spins, Wild Symbols, Locked Wilds, Stoned Wilds |
| Demo | No demo linked |

RTP: 97.10%
An RTP of 97.10% is genuinely high for an online slot. The industry benchmark sits around 96%, which puts Medusa II 1.10 points above the 96% benchmark. For every $100 you cycle through this game over the long run, the math returns around $97 — that's $1 to $2 more per $100 than you'd get from the average game on the same shelf. That gap adds up across a full session. NetEnt doesn't publish RTPs this strong often, which makes the number worth noting.
Volatility: Medium
The Medium volatility on Medusa II is its most underrated quality. High-variance slots get the marketing — the giant multipliers, the life-changing ceilings — but medium-volatility games are where most players actually finish a session up. The math is set up to give you regular feedback, which means you're more likely to be near your original bet size when the feature eventually lands.
